Course

Learn Programming Dublin

Share this course:

Hourly rates:
1 student: GBP £25.00
2 students: GBP £22.00
3+ students: GBP £18.00
Fees apply. View details.


Learn Programming

C# MVC

Course description:


This course assumes you have covered the details in the previous courses (a programming level at least past object oriented principles).

It will cover how to write an MVC application, they implied layers involved and how to separate them into actual physical layers in the software.

Teaching approach:


Assuming a basic understanding of programming concepts obtained from the previous course. We will build on that here by explaining what MVC is, and how such a program is structured. Introducing basic design patterns (generic repository, dependency injection etc.) and explaining when they should be used. We will take a look at entity framework as the data access layer, and how to separate that out, and also how to separate out domain (business), service (Web API), and UI layers.

Places where you can take this course:


Programming classes, Dublin
Tea house: The Gate Bar
155 Crumlin Rd, Crumlin, Dublin 15, Ireland
Programming classes, Dublin
Tea house: Sheary's Bar & Lounge
1 Bangor Dr, Crumlin, Dublin 12, Ireland
Programming classes, Dublin
Online
(Skype)

Private registration Private / Semi-private:


Hourly rates:

1 student:GBP £25.00*
2 students:GBP £22.00 per student*
3+ students:GBP £18.00 per student*

* Plus GBP £2.00 administration fee per class (per student)
* Single-class purchase fee: GBP £2.00 (per student)


Class duration options:

Online: 60, 90, 120, 180 minutes

In person: 90, 120, 180, 240 minutes

Group sessions Group sessions:


There are no group sessions at the moment.

Request a new group session >


Interested in this course?

  • Tell the teacher about you or your group
  • Book your own classes
  • Learn at your own pace

Free registration  Similar courses >


Add to my list Add to my list

Contact the teacher Contact the teacher

Your first name:

Your last name:

Email address:

Your message to the teacher:

Please leave empty:

Receive news about teachers and courses Maybe later?

Leave your e-mail address:
We will keep you informed.

Teacher:

Francis Rodgers

Mother language: English

Spoken languages: English


ABOUT THE TEACHER

I am a professional software engineer and IT consultant. I enjoy helping others to become successful at their IT career and helping them to fast track their way to their goals by helping them set realistic goals and achieve them. I am very interested in all things technology related.


TEACHER EDUCATION

BSc Software Development - IT Sligo, 2012.

MSc Web technologies - NCI, 2014.

TEACHER EXPERIENCE

I have taught many college students both while in college and after and helped them get better grades.

Courses by this teacher:

Learn Programming: Programming in C#

Learn Programming: Database Design & Development - SQL Server / Acces

Learn Office: Personal Finance Management

Learn Office: CV & LinkedIn profile improvement

How does it work?


Private classes:


  • Step 2

    Register to the course of your choice

    • Tell the teacher about you or your group
    • Choose a location from the proposed list
  • Step 3

    Add funds to your account

    • Use a credit card or PayPal to add money to your account
    • Your money can be used for any course, with any teacher
  • Step 4

    Start booking your classes!

    • Use the course calendar to book your own classes
    • Attend your classes and start learning!

Group sessions:


  • Find the course and group session that is best for you.
  • Register to the group session by making your payment.
  • Payments can be made by credit card or with PayPal.

Interested in this course?

  • Tell the teacher about you or your group
  • Book your own classes
  • Learn at your own pace

Free registration


Similar courses:


Programming Courses >

Programming Courses in Dublin >


Payment methods

Pay with a credit card or with PayPal